Q: How much does it cost to unlock a car?
A: The cost to unlock a car can differ depending on the circumstance and the locksmith. On average, you can expect to pay in between ₤ 20 and ₤ 100 for a fundamental car unlock. If the key is broken inside the lock or if the service is offered in an emergency, the cost may be higher.
Q: Can a car locksmith replace a lost key?
A: Yes, a car locksmith can replace a lost key. They can create a new key utilizing the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) or a pre-existing key if you have one. For contemporary cars with keyless entry systems, they can likewise program a brand-new key fob.
Q: Is it legal to have a car locksmith open my car if I don't have the key?
A: Yes, it is legal for a car locksmith to open your car if you don't have the key, however they will require evidence that you are the owner of the vehicle. This can include a driver's license, vehicle registration, and often a notarized statement.
Q: How long does it consider a car locksmith to get here?
A: The action time for a car locksmith can differ depending on their accessibility and your location. Many locksmith professionals use a 30-minute to 1-hour action time, especially for emergency situation services.
Q: Can a car locksmith change the locks on my car?
A: Yes, a car locksmith can alter the locks on your car. This is often provided for security factors, especially if you've just recently acquired a pre-owned car or if you presume that someone has actually damaged your vehicle's locks.
